Favorites servers already exist for Mount and Blade, Warband, not only cRPG.
Launch your game, go to "Multiplayer", "Join a game". Select your server. Instead of clicking on "Connection" bottom right, click on "add to favorites" bottom middle.
Then, top left-middle, there's Source :"internet" in a scrollbar already selected. There, you can click and choose "Favorites", to see all your recorded favorites servers..
Just be aware, when there's a major update concerning servers, you'll just have to add them again to your favorites.
Don't know what steam has to do with this, though.